Dr Okonjo-Iweala laments non arrival of INEC staff, says she’s been waiting for one hour

Dr Ngozi Okonjo-Iweala, the Director General of the World Trade Organization (WTO), has lamented the non arrival of staff of the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) at her polling unit in Abia State.

According to the former Finance Minister, she has been waiting for over an hour, along with several villagers at her ward, but no sign of INEC staff yet.

She said: “Waiting to vote at my polling station in Umuda Isingwu village Umuahia, Abia State.

“I have been waiting one hour. Many villagers have been here since 7 am. It is 11.23 am now. Where are the INEC officers??”
